>100-200k earners would be middle middle?
100-200k for households puts you in the top 10%. Individuals, maybe top 5%. How is that not upper class!?
I wish I was even low middle according to your scale...
For reference:
Income in 1999
Households..................................105,539,122 100.0
Less than $10,000............................10,067,027 9.5
$10,000 to $14,999............................6,657,228 6.3
$15,000 to $24,999...........................13,536,965 12.8
$25,000 to $34,999...........................13,519,242 12.8
$35,000 to $49,999...........................17,446,272 16.5
$50,000 to $74,999...........................20,540,604 19.5
$75,000 to $99,999...........................10,799,245 10.2
$100,000 to $149,999..........................8,147,826 7.7
$150,000 to $199,999..........................2,322,038 2.2
$200,000 or more............................. 2,502,675 2.4
Median family income (dollars)..................50,046
Per capita income (dollars).....................21,587
Median earnings (dollars):
Male full-time, year-round workers..............37,057
Female full-time, year-round workers............27,194
http://censtats.census.gov/data/US/01000.pdf http://censtats.census.gov/data/US/01000.pdf
